Maharaja’s High School and PU College seeks funds for repair works

Alumni Association celebrates Mummadi Krishnaraja Wadiyar Jayanti 

Mysore/Mysuru: Maharaja’s High School and PU College Alumni Association celebrated Mummadi Krishnaraja Wadiyar Jayanti and Founder’s Day by garlanding and showering flower petals on the bust of the late Maharaja in front of the institution in city recently.

President of the Alumni Association B.S. Sridhara Raj Urs along with Principal Siddaraju, Vice-Principal Dr. D. Mahesh, Secretary M.R. Suresh, Joint Secretary Rangaswamy, Senior Journalist  Satish, old students Shyam Prasad, Raghavendra, Balasubramanyam, lecturers and others were present.

Later, Vice-Principal Dr. Mahesh, in his welcome address, expressed his happiness for the initiative taken by Sridhara Raj Urs in holding the event during Covid pandemic.

Stating that the back portion of the building requires repair and painting while the front portion was renovated, he requested  the Alumni Association members for financial help in  carrying out  minimum repairs works.

Sridhara Raj Urs, speaking on the occasion, said that he would give Rs.10,000 on behalf of the Association and gave a token amount of Rs.5,000 on the spot as advance to the Vice-Principal. 

He pointed out that at his initiative last year, an estimate for about Rs.1.4 crore for repair and painting works had been prepared by the PWD, Mysuru and submitted to the Department of Public Instruction through the Education Secretary. He said that he would write to the Education Minister to sanction funds for the institution that was built by the late Maharaja.

He further said that the alumni association would take up the false ceiling work of the library to improve its acoustics and  beautify it at a cost of about Rs. 2 lakh.
